The Real Powerhouse: B Vitamins

If any group of nutrients could be considered a 'super' complex for the brain, it would be the B vitamins. These water-soluble vitamins are absolutely vital for optimal brain function, playing interconnected roles in cellular energy production, DNA synthesis, and neurotransmitter creation. Deficiencies in various B vitamins can quickly lead to cognitive issues.

B-Vitamins and Their Brain-Specific Functions

  • Vitamin B6 (Pyridoxine): Essential for the synthesis of neurotransmitters like serotonin, dopamine, and GABA, which are crucial for mood, sleep, and regulating neural activity.
  • Vitamin B9 (Folate): Plays a critical role in DNA and RNA synthesis and repair, and low levels are linked to increased cognitive decline and higher homocysteine levels.
  • Vitamin B12 (Cobalamin): Works closely with folate and is essential for nerve cell health and the formation of red blood cells, which carry oxygen to the brain. A deficiency is particularly common in older adults and can cause memory loss and confusion.

The Critical Role of Omega-3 Fatty Acids

Beyond traditional vitamins, omega-3 fatty acids are indispensable for brain structure and function. The brain is about 60% fat, and a large portion of this is made up of omega-3s, particularly DHA.

How Omega-3s Support Your Mind

Omega-3s, namely EPA and DHA, are integral components of brain cell membranes. They are responsible for several key functions:

  • Structural Integrity: They ensure the fluidity and flexibility of brain cell membranes, which is essential for effective communication between neurons.
  • Anti-Inflammatory Effects: EPA and DHA help to balance inflammatory processes in the brain, which are linked to cognitive decline and neurodegenerative diseases.
  • Blood Flow: Research suggests that omega-3s may increase blood flow to the brain, enhancing cognitive function and memory.

Vitamins D and E: The Neuroprotective Duo

While B vitamins and omega-3s handle the foundational architecture and maintenance, vitamins D and E provide crucial neuroprotective support.

The Sunshine Vitamin and Cognitive Function

Vitamin D is often called the “sunshine vitamin” and its active form binds to receptors throughout the brain to regulate mood and cognitive function. Low vitamin D levels have been linked to cognitive impairment, depression, and neurodegenerative diseases. While the evidence for supplementation directly boosting cognitive function in healthy individuals is mixed, maintaining sufficient levels is important for overall brain health.

Vitamin E as an Antioxidant Shield

Vitamin E is a powerful antioxidant that combats free radicals, which cause damage through oxidative stress. The brain is especially vulnerable to this type of damage due to its high metabolic rate, and oxidative stress increases with age. Protecting brain cells from this damage is a primary function of vitamin E, and a high intake from food sources has been associated with better cognitive performance.

Comparing Key Nutrients for Brain Health

Nutrient Primary Brain Function Food Sources Notes on Supplementation
B Vitamins (B6, B9, B12) Neurotransmitter synthesis, DNA repair, nerve health, homocysteine metabolism. Leafy greens, meat, fish, dairy, eggs, fortified cereals. Most healthy people get enough from diet. Key for vegetarians/vegans (B12) and older adults with malabsorption issues.
Omega-3s (DHA, EPA) Cell membrane fluidity, anti-inflammatory, neurotransmission. Fatty fish (salmon, mackerel), flaxseeds, walnuts. Important for those with low fish intake. Supplements are an option, but efficacy varies by condition.
Vitamin D Regulates mood and cognitive function, neuroprotection. Sunlight exposure, fatty fish, fortified milk/cereals. Deficiency is common. Supplementation may be necessary, especially in winter or for older adults.
Vitamin E Antioxidant protection against free radicals and oxidative stress. Nuts, seeds, vegetable oils, dark leafy greens. High doses from supplements can be risky. Food sources are generally preferred.

The Role of Lifestyle Factors

Nutrients are crucial, but a healthy brain also depends on a supportive lifestyle. Regular physical activity, adequate sleep, and managing stress are all major contributors to cognitive wellness. Physical exercise increases blood flow to the brain, sleep is essential for memory consolidation and clearing metabolic waste, and stress management techniques help regulate hormones that can impact neural function. Combining a nutrient-dense diet with these healthy habits provides the most robust foundation for long-term brain health.
